Uttarakhand CM Congratulates Young Climbers on Mount Kilimanjaro Ascent

Uttarakhand Chief Minister Pushkar Singh Dhami congratulated nine- and ten-year-old mountaineers Riyansh Pant and Prisha Rawat for successfully summiting Mount Kilimanjaro, Africa's highest peak. The children, from Almora and Nainital districts, unfurled the Indian flag at the summit on August 22, 2026. Dhami praised their courage and determination, highlighting their achievement as a source of pride for Uttarakhand and an inspiration for youth to pursue ambitious goals. The state government emphasized its commitment to supporting young talent in adventure activities.
